Your mileage WILL NOT go up with any tuner unless you remove the dpf. All you will do is force it to go into regen more often which will cause you mileage to be even worse. Plus puting on a tuner will void your warranty even if you leave the dpf on. They leave a foot print that the dealer can see. The Spartan Phalanx is the only tuner (so far) not leaving a foot print. At least that is what I am hearing from guys who have had theirs in the shop, and Spartan as well. I think that a Ford rep can tell if they look deep enough but it cant be found at the dealer level. Either love your Ford the way it is or take a chance with the warranty.
